The second one was new to me. Great description of the cars potential. And to think that the drive system in this car shares so much similarity to the very first over 27 years ago. I don’t know why people are putting so much emphasis on the r8 as being Audi’s super car. What could be more super then a four door full weighted car evoking so many pleasant feelings, driving pleasure in every condition and season. They really put in the extra effort in the RS4 to make it have the feel that very few newer models had. Taking the lead from the m3 is really a big thing and BMW had it coming. The quattro and true manual gearbox are something that will never age or be changed. DSG and all the other computer stuff is cool, but there’s just noting as pure as controlling the car and experience fully. I think it would be cool to see Audi produce a factory GT car to run along side the LMP1. I guess DTM has always fended off any attempts at that idea.

ummm... guess you haven't been following the news eh?
The RS4 is leagues ahead of the E46 M3 and all the UK mag tests are saying the RS4 is VERY close in performance to the E92 M3 and some have even gone as far as to say the RS4 was a better car as an overall package. The RS4 is already two years old and so far the tests are saying the new M3 is pretty equal to the RS4. So its hardly putting Audi back 5 years. Audi is also releasing their B8 A4 next year, so the next RS (be it RS5 or RS4) will come out and probably trump the M3 for a couple years until bmw redesigns again.
And if its RWD, it wouldn't be an Audi.
